A new biography by Baltimore author Elizabeth Evitts Dickinson puts fashion pioneer Claire McCardell back at the center of American style. “Claire McCardell: The Designer Who Set Women Free” says that the Frederick-born designer revolutionized women’s clothing from the 1930s through the 1950s. Jun 16, 2025 08:40 AM IST 47-year-old Blaise Metreweli, the first woman to head MI6, joined the foreign intelligence service of the United Kingdom in 1999.
